Online Systems and Developments

The check here landscape of streaming content transmission is undergoing a rapid transformation, driven by evolving systems and shifting consumer preferences. Adaptive bitrate transmission, which dynamically adjusts content quality based on network conditions, remains vital for providing a seamless viewing encounter. Furthermore, the rise of Low-Latency transmission – crucial for real-time events like gaming – is gaining considerable traction. We’re also witnessing increased implementation of technologies like AV1, a next-generation media codec, promising improved quality and reduced bandwidth consumption. Finally, cloud-based delivery and edge computing are evolving into increasingly essential for scaling content services and minimizing latency globally.
